A man from southern Illinois has been charged, in regard to painting swastikas on dozens of gravestones over this past Memorial Day weekend. Reports say that in addition to the swastikas on over 200 graves at the Sunset Hill Cemetery, the man allegedly painted additional swastikas on houses in Edwardsville. 34-year-old Timothy McLean of Glen Carbon also got charged with painting swastikas on 3 churches and at least 2 homes in Glen Carbon. McLean’s record goes back as far as an underage drinking violation when he was 16-years-old. Some of the other charges that he faces includes calling the Edwardsville Police Department to make racially derogatory comments, aggravated assault to an officer, disorderly conduct and resisting arrest. McLean is also being held on $100,000 bond at the Madison County Jail.
